Top american leaders often have problems with israel, which depends heavily on american support. Gunfire. But doesnt necessarily do what the us wants. Usually, though, american officials keep quiet about it. Not so the us deputy secretary of state, kurt campbell. He said publicly the other day, israels leaders mostly talk about the idea of a sweeping victory on the battlefield, but the Biden Administration didnt believe such a thing was possible. Neither do many other observers. So why is israel pursuing the idea, and why is Benjamin Netanyahu so willing to ignore what the us wants . I put these questions to shaina oppenheimer, a journalist with bbc monitoring injerusalem. First and foremost, he has some very far right Coalition Partners who have been very hawkish and very clear with him that they want to see the government do certain things, for example, for it to press ahead with a full scale invasion of rafah.
